How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Aztec?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Aztec Studio Apartments | $1,167 | $558 | $1,395 |
| Aztec 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,463 | $593 | $1,980 |
| Aztec 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,894 | $626 | $2,474 |
| Aztec 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,981 | $713 | $2,850 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Aztec
How much are Studio apartments in Aztec?
There are currently 7 Studio Apartments in Aztec with rent ranges from $558 to $1,395 with an average price of $1,167.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Aztec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Aztec ranges from $593 to $1,980 with an average monthly rent of $1,463.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Aztec c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Aztec range from $626 to $2,474.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,894.
How expensive are Aztec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 5 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Aztec on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$713 to $2,850 - averaging $1,981 for the location.
